Iran - Capture Fisheries Production Volume
Since 2014, Iran Capture Fisheries Production Volume increased 6.4% year on year. With 845,699 Metric Tons in 2019, the country was number 24 among other countries in Capture Fisheries Production Volume. Iran is overtaken by Canada, which was number 23 with 883,856.45 Metric Tons and is followed by Argentina with 829,818 Metric Tons. China topped the ranking with 15,152,402.13 Metric Tons in 2019, +2.2% versus 2018. Indonesia, Peru and India resp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Georgia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+59.9% per year, while Vanuatu recorded the worst performance at -44.9% per year.
